Of course this doesn't apply to the leaders of the "the Right" and the elites they serve; it just applies to the muppets who vote for them; put on funny uniforms and fight for them; buy into convenient myths of nationalism and chauvinism and then live their lives in the interests of their rulers.

However, so much of what we believe and think we know comes from how we are raised and (mis)informed; I think often the political postures we take have less to do with what might be called intelligence than with the ideological environment in which we live and learn.

Some people will blithely say "Oh well, no-one wants a radical alternative because they are all stupid" or "true socialism can't work because people are thick/selfish", but truthfully most people (all of us) most often do stupid things not because we're stupid but because we have never been taught how to question, how to think, or that we might believe that the world might be organised another way or any number of other ways.

"Right-wing politics is all about small government and personal freedom"

Well that would be a huge generalisation. Whilst I agree with you that authoritarianism is done at least as well by the Old Left in all its guises as the Right, you ignore the fact libertarianism has been hugely important for many "leftists" over the last two centuries.

The thrust of this article was that people deemed to be less intelligent tend to be prejudiced in ways which correlate with the appeals of right wing political movements.

My own point of view is that anybody, intelligent or not, who looks at politicians of any stripe and thinks they see people who are genuinely going to help them has a mental problem.

Authoritarians of the left and the right have pretty much equally proved themselves to be murderous bast*rds; so, what can we conclude? What is required is more liberty not less; more democracy not less; less of a role or no role at all for politicians and politics as we have known it.......

Up to this point libertarians of right and left may well be in agreement. The problem; the important dispute after that is a very practical one: how should the economy be organised to ensre the survival of the liberty we value? For me the answer is democracy in every community and every workplace; an end to capitalism and bosses forever....... for the libertarians of the right? I don't know.... the freedom to let the poor starve; the freedom to live in their fortresses whilst others fight over the scraps?

I have strayed a long way from the rather simplistic point in the article, but I have done so to make a point: political and philosophical questions should be discussed with an open mind rather than dismissed with prejudice; that surely is the mark of an intelligent position.
